
Yolanda Reyes
Yolanda Reyes is a Colombian writer and educator known for her contributions to children's literature and her advocacy for educational reform in Colombia. With a focus on the importance of reading and storytelling, Reyes has published numerous books that aim to inspire young readers. In her recent column, she highlights the critical state of education in Colombia, addressing issues such as school dropout rates and the challenges faced by students in both urban and rural areas. Her work often emphasizes the need for systemic change and greater investment in education to ensure that all children have access to quality learning experiences.
